About The Position

PMC SMART Solutions is hiring a Business Development Manager to drive new business growth by identifying, developing, and securing opportunities that align with PMC's strategic objectives and customer needs. This role offers the chance to shape PMC's future growth by partnering closely with account management, engineering, supply chain, and operations to deliver innovative, customer-focused solutions for leading medical device OEMs and automotive tier 1 OEMs. PMC SMART Solutions has a long history as a leader in plastic injection molding and contract manufacturing, serving industry leaders with precision-engineered medical devices and automotive components.
